INTRENCHMENT

In*trench"ment, n. Etym: [From Intrench.]

1. The act of intrenching or the state of being intrenched.

2. (Mil.)

Definition: Any defensive work consisting of at least a trench or ditch and a parapet made from the earth thrown up in making such a ditch. On our side, we have thrown up intrenchments on Winter and Prospect Hills. Washington.

3. Any defense or protection.

4. An encroachment or infringement. The slight intrenchment upon individual freedom. Southey.
